Spraggins Neighborhood Overview
Overview
Spraggins is a well-established, primarily residential neighborhood located in the northeastern quadrant of Tupelo, Mississippi. It is conveniently situated near the intersection of McCullough Boulevard and Cliff Gookin Boulevard, placing it within easy reach of Tupelo's major retail corridors, healthcare facilities, and the city's bustling downtown. The neighborhood's development largely took place in the mid-to-late 20th century, resulting in a mature landscape of tree-lined streets and settled homes that offer a quiet, suburban feel while remaining integrated into the city's fabric.
The character of Spraggins is one of stability and community. It is a neighborhood where residents take pride in homeownership, evident in the well-maintained properties and manicured lawns. Its location provides a sense of seclusion from the busiest commercial traffic, yet it is just minutes from virtually every essential service and amenity Tupelo has to offer. This balance of tranquility and convenience is a defining feature of the Spraggins area, making it a perennial choice for families and professionals.
Housing & Real Estate
The housing stock in Spraggins consists predominantly of single-family homes ranging from mid-century ranches and split-levels to larger traditional two-story houses built through the 1980s and 1990s. Lot sizes are typically generous, providing ample yard space. The architectural styles are varied but lean towards classic American suburban designs, with brick and vinyl siding being common exterior materials. The neighborhood presents a very high rate of owner-occupancy, with a relatively low percentage of rental properties.
Price ranges in Spraggins are considered moderate to upper-moderate for the Tupelo market, often sitting above the city's median home value. Homes here are in consistent demand due to the neighborhood's reputation, central location, and proximity to top-rated schools. Recent trends show steady appreciation, with homes selling efficiently. The market is competitive for well-priced, updated properties, though the neighborhood also offers value for homes that may require some modernization, appealing to buyers looking to put their own stamp on a property in a desirable area.
Schools & Education
Spraggins is zoned for the highly regarded Tupelo Public School District, a significant draw for families. Students typically attend Pierce Street Elementary School, which is located just a short distance from the neighborhood. They then progress to Milam Elementary for 5th and 6th grades, followed by Tupelo Middle School and the award-winning Tupelo High School. The district is known for its strong academic programs, extensive extracurricular activities, and consistent high performance on state and national metrics.
In addition to the public school pathway, several private educational options are accessible nearby, including Tupelo Christian Preparatory School and All Saints' Episcopal School. For higher education, the neighborhood is approximately a 15-minute drive from the main campus of Itawamba Community College (ICC) in Tupelo, and the Mississippi University for Women and Mississippi State University are within a reasonable commuting distance for faculty, staff, and students.
Parks & Recreation
Residents of Spraggins enjoy convenient access to Tupelo's extensive park system. The neighborhood is less than a mile from the sprawling Ballard Park, which serves as a major recreational hub. Ballard Park features multiple sports fields, tennis courts, a disc golf course, walking trails, and a popular playground complex. Its open spaces are frequently used for community leagues, casual play, and family gatherings.
For more structured fitness and aquatic activities, the Tupelo Aquatic Center and the nearby Tupelo Tennis Center are both within a quick drive. While Spraggins itself is more residential, its perimeter along Cliff Gookin Boulevard offers easy connections to the Natchez Trace Parkway. This provides unparalleled opportunities for scenic biking, hiking, jogging, and historical exploration just minutes from home, connecting residents with the region's natural beauty.
Local Dining & Shopping
Spraggins is exceptionally well-positioned for everyday convenience and retail therapy. The neighborhood is adjacent to Tupelo's primary commercial district along North Gloster Street and McCullough Boulevard. Within a five-minute drive, residents can access Barnes Crossing Mall, a vast array of big-box retailers, and every major grocery chain, including Kroger, Walmart Supercenter, and Aldi. This makes routine shopping exceptionally efficient.
The dining scene nearby is diverse and caters to all tastes. From fast-casual chains to local favorites, options abound. Notable nearby eateries include the upscale Grill at Fairpark, local staple Woody's Tupelo Burgers & Fries, and a variety of national and regional sit-down restaurants. For more unique shopping and dining experiences, the revitalized downtown Tupelo district, with its boutique shops, cafes, and the renowned Blue Canoe music venue, is only a short 10-minute drive to the southwest.

Spraggins Market Data
| Metric | Value |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Median Home Price | $225K |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Median Gross Rent | $825/mo |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Median Household Income | $39K |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Homeownership Rate | 85.2%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Renter-Occupied | 14.8%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Rental Vacancy Rate | 45.1%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Market Type | Buyer's |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Primary ZIP Code | 38601 |
